    • @flurpoid
      @flurpoid 7 месяцев назад +2

      I've had multiple fiberglass boards and it's always a problem eventually as the fiberglass on the edges is uncovered due to wear. One solution is just hitting the edges with a bit of spray-on polyurethane clear coat, just be sure to mask off any surfaces you don't want extra clear coat on.
